But on the real note, the minister was saying figuretaively that the country should be the 37th state of Nigeria and not necessarily mean they want to join Nigeria to become a country, the following are his personal words on the matter; Along with my colleagues, Rauf Aregbesola and Niyi Adebayo met with our Benin Republic counterparts led by the Minister of Foreign Affairs and Cooperation, Mr. Aurelien, Mr. Romuald Wadagni, Minister of Economy and Finance, Mrs. Shadiya Assouman, Minister of Industry and Trade..

Also Mr. Sacca Lafia, Minister of Interior of the Republic of Benin. This Interministerial meeting is to reach a bilateral agreement between our two countries to curb smuggling activities and workout a sustainable modality between Nigeria and Benin Republic. A bilateral relationship to curb smuggling and inflow of arms and amuniton from the Benin land boarders.
